Because of the pandemic, the students have less access to books at the school library. They also have faced many challenges with needing to be social-distanced at school including less recess, games, and activities, etc. Having more books in the classroom would really help give them something fun and educational to do. The only books we have in the classroom are ones I have bought with my own money, and we have a limited supply. I would really love for the kids to have books both fiction and nonfiction in different genres, so they can discover their interests. I believe having more exciting books to choose from will increase their love of reading and their reading skills. Some of my students come from low-income families and don't have books at home. I would love for them to be able to borrow books from the classroom to take home.
